Transaction 075af31755dc2344a4e4fa1e5524c6db117ffed773d82efa414b8252769ef22d
1 Input
2 Outputs
- 075af31755dc2344a4e4fa1e5524c6db117ffed773d82efa414b8252769ef22d:0
- 075af31755dc2344a4e4fa1e5524c6db117ffed773d82efa414b8252769ef22d:1
value 1425500
address 19cF6WdFfWCuaVDsWH55it3Z5Ab6ymRiph
value 29565410
address 36zw2y5FyoFWZGSw3z8U5jU5qCxCwJkuP3